🤖AI Intelligence Saturday Racing's analytical engine

Saturday Racing AI
Betties Bay
Confidence: Medium

Betties Bay (SR 90, 4/1) is the clear class-leader in this field with a form string of /11112 — four wins from five starts, with the sole defeat a second place, indicating a horse at the top of its form cycle. At 9-6 it carries a manageable weight and the SR-90 is 4 points clear of the next-best Cayman Tai (SR 86), a meaningful edge at this level. The market is confident without being extravagant at 4/1, suggesting informed money without excessive shortening that would compress value. James Owen sends out a horse in peak form on Good ground over a trip that suits a front-running profile evidenced by the repeated wins. Each-way alternative: Cayman Tai. Main danger: Cayman Tai — Cayman Tai (SR 86, 11/2) carries 3lb less than Betties Bay and the form 253212 shows absolute consistency at this level with a second last time out, suggesting a horse ready to graduate from placed efforts.
